RecDB is An Open Source Recommendation Engine Built Entirely Inside PostgreSQL 9.2. RecDB allows application developers to build recommendation applications in a heartbeat through a wide variety of built-in recommendation algorithms like user-user collaborative filtering, item-item collaborative filtering, singular value decomposition. Applications powered by RecDB can produce online and flexible personalized recommendations to end-users. RecDB has the following main features:
- Usability: RecDB is an out-of-the-box tool for web and mobile developers to implement a myriad of recommendation applications. The system is easily used and configured so that a novice developer can define a variety of recommenders that fits the application needs in few lines of SQL.
- Seamless Database Integration: Crafted inside PostgreSQL database engine, RecDB is able to seamlessly integrate the recommendation functionality with traditional database operations, i.e., SELECT, PROJECT, JOIN, in the query pipeline to execute ad-hoc recommendation queries.
- 'Scalability and Performance: 'The system optimizes incoming recommendation queries (written in SQL) and hence provides near real-time personalized recommendation to a high number of end-users who expressed their opinions over a large pool of items.
